Leaf Rust Resistance in Selected Uruguayan Common Wheat Cultivars with Early Maturity

2012-03-01

Abstract excerpt

Leaf rust (caused by Puccinia triticina Eriks.) is an important disease of wheat (Triticum aestivum L.) in Uruguay; therefore breeding for resistance to this disease has been a long-term objective for the INIA wheat-breeding program.
